Search AOL for LinkedIn profiles based on title

The following search script will help you search for candidates based on title using AOL. The search syntax is: "Title" (site:linkedin.com/in OR site:linkedin.com/pub) -'pub/dir' For example, if you want to search for LinkedIn profiles with title "Director of Marketing", the search string will be: "Director of Marketing" (site:linkedin.com/in OR site:linkedin.com/pub) -'pub/dir' Source: eGrabber Newsletter

6 tips to hire candidates on Twitter

Twitter can be your powerful recruiting tool if you do things in the right way. Try the following: Use hash tags when you share a job opening. It makes the tweet searchable and will help you reach people beyond your followers. Don't just tweet about jobs. Mix up your tweets with news, updates, events, happenings at your company, etc. Respond when an interested candidate replies to your tweet. Else, she might move away. Automating tweets is the order of the day. But that isn't social. Your followers will figure it out.  Have someone to manage and engage your  followers. Check your prospective candidates' profile and timeline to know about them.  Encourage candidates to have conversations on Twitter. Source: eGrabber Newsletter

Search Google for LinkedIn profiles based on Company & Title

The following search script will help you to search Google for LinkedIn profiles based on Company & Title. The search syntax is: "Company" "Title" (site:linkedin.com/pub OR site:linkedin.com/in) -"pub/dir" For example, if you want to build a list of 'Project Manager' profiles at 'IBM', the search script will be:  "IBM""Project Manager" (site:linkedin.com/pub OR site:linkedin.com/in)-"pub/dir" Source: eGrabber Newsletters

3 tips to attract your audience on LinkedIn

If you want to leverage social media, you got to know the knack of attracting your audience. If you want to do it on LinkedIn, you got to align your content to your audience's needs and interests. Try the following: Create quality content that is easily consumable and valuable; something your connections would like to share. Don't use too many targeting filters and miss out on potential audiences. Try and experiment with a variety of updates & combinations - informative, inspirational, insightful & entertaining posts. Find out what works best for you. Source: eGrabber Newsletters
